Marla is a resident of 889 River Rd #Bld-1, Teaneck, Nj 07666. The possible relatives of Marla are Maurice Miller, Alice F Miller, Jennifer Marie Parkinson and 2 other people. Marla turned 53 years old. Marla owns the phone number (201) 836-1579. Marla was born in 1971. Public records show Hackensack as a city Marla also stayed in.